Prez. Weah Calls for Collective Involvement of all Liberians in Addressing the Country’s Mounting Challenges

Cotton Tree, Margibi County, Liberia – President George Weah has stressed the need for politicians to work together for the common good of the Country.

President Weah said being on the other side of the political divide should not stand in the way of the overall national development goal.

Speaking Tuesday at Town Hall Meeting in Cotton Tree, the Liberian Leader acknowledged the cherished unity existing among leaders of Margibi County.

President Weah made specific reference to the collaboration built over the years with some members of the Margibi Legislative Caucus including Senators Jim Tornorla and Emmanuel Nuquay during his days at the Legislature.

The Liberian Leader assured a smooth working relationship between the Presidency and the Margibi Legislative Caucus if they remain united in the interest of the County.
